Tyres designed as part of the driving experience
For this model, Michelin and Mercedes‑AMG worked together from the earliest stages, not to design a generic tyre, but to build a complete driving experience.
The flagship tyre, the MICHELIN Pilot Sport S 5 MO1, reflects this philosophy. It features a tread made of four different rubber compounds to balance dry grip, wet safety and durability.
The challenges were significant: supporting a high-performance electric vehicle with instant torque, high load, and speeds exceeding 300 km/h while maintaining stability and comfort.
To meet these demands, Michelin developed:
Reinforced carcass structures for stability and high-speed resistance,
Acoustic foam technology to reduce cabin noise, key for an EV (except MICHELIN Pilot Sport Cup 2 R),
Advanced simulation combined with real-world testing to fine-tune performance.
The objective is simple: deliver total confidence, whether driving daily or pushing track limits.
Tyre Options for Every Season and Track
Unlike traditional fitments, this Mercedes-AMG benefits from a full Michelin range tailored to different driving scenarios:
Summer performance tyres (MICHELIN Pilot Sport 5 EnergyTM, MICHELIN Pilot Sport S 5) for efficiency and high grip
Track-focused option (MICHELIN Pilot Sport Cup 2 R) for maximum performance on circuit
Winter solutions (MICHELIN Pilot Alpin 5) for cold conditions
All-season tyres (MICHELIN Pilot Sport All Season 4) for versatility (US only)
All tyres carry Mercedes-AMG-specific markings (MO1), ensuring they match the vehicle’s setup and performance targets.
This approach allows every driver, from daily commuters to track enthusiasts, to experience the same core Mercedes-AMG character.
